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management LLC raised its stake in shares of Universal Display Corporation (NASDAQ:OLED - Free Report) by 73.8%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 4,407,846 shares of the semiconductor company's stock after purchasing an additional 1,871,333 shares during the period. Universal Display accounts for approximately 1.5% of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management LLC's holdings, making the stock its 15th biggest position.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management LLC owned 9.27% of Universal Display worth $614,806,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Universal Display (NASDAQ:OLED -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The semiconductor company reported $1.41 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.18 by $0.23. Universal Display had a net margin of 36.95% and a return on equity of 15.82%. The firm had revenue of $171.79 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$161.58 million.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$1.10 earnings per share. The company's revenue was up 8.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Universal Display Profile

(Free Report)

Universal Display Corporation engages in the research, development, and commercialization of organic light emitting diode (OLED) technologies and materials for use in display and solid-state lighting applications in the United States and internationally. The company offers PHOLED technologies and materials for displays and lighting products under the UniversalPHOLED brand.
